"There are business models out there that will disrupt industries with a completely different way of working. If you’re competing on products and technology alone, good luck – your risk. Think of competing on business models," emphasized Alex Osterwalder, the inventor of the Business Model Canvas, in his keynote at Nordic Business Forum Norway in January.
Key points:
• Business models and value propositions expire faster than ever before, so constantly innovation is crucial.
• 4 out of 100 innovations actually become successful - innovation without failure doesn’t exist.
• Every CEO should spend at least 1-2 days of their week concentrating on innovation.
Innovate not only on products and technologies but business models as well.
